If you start with tunnel vision, what ability would you go for second? It's either Showboat, Beat Down, or Monster Hit. Thinking Showboat.

idk if I'd go tunnel vision on a LB, the hit to Blitz Awareness will leave your guys helpless on outside pitches. I'd go first step/showboat

Originally posted by Reppowarrior
What are some reasons to not go with Beat Down over Trash Talk?
Beat Down is fine for DTs and maybe even DEs (depends on build and role), but for Rookie, LBs get an overwhelming amount of the sacks and thus should have Showboat.

Originally posted by Time Trial
How many rev cakes have you had? If you aren't getting 50 or more a season, ask yourself if Beat Down will fire often enough.
And... beat down only impacts the player you're revcaking. Showboat will hammer the entire offense with morale, and buff your entire defense at the same time.
